Northern Sunrise County is a special type of local government area called a municipal district. It is located in northern Alberta, Canada. Think of it like a big county that includes smaller towns and communities.

Its main office is found just east of the town of Peace River. This office is where the local government works to serve the people living in the county.

History of Northern Sunrise County

This area has not always been called Northern Sunrise County. Before July 10, 2002, it was known by a different name: the Municipal District of East Peace No. 131. The change to Northern Sunrise County marked a new chapter for the region.

Population of Northern Sunrise County

Understanding the population helps us know how many people live in an area. This information comes from a count called a census.

2021 Population Count

In 2021, Statistics Canada counted the population of Northern Sunrise County. There were 1,711 people living there. These people lived in 658 homes.

The total area of the county is about 20,915 square kilometers. This means the population density was very low, with only about 0.1 people per square kilometer. This shows it's a very spread-out area.

Population Changes Over Time

The population of Northern Sunrise County has changed a bit over the years.

  • In 2016, the population was 1,891 people.
  • This means the population decreased slightly between 2016 and 2021.

Local governments also sometimes do their own counts. In 2013, a local census counted 1,933 people. They also counted an extra 592 non-permanent people, like workers, bringing the total to 2,525 at that time.
